Java Programming for Complete Beginners - Java 16 - Step 01 - Understanding Java Versions - 10000 Feet Overview

Java Programming for Complete Beginners - Java 16 - Step 01 - Understanding Java Versions - 10000 Feet Overview

Assessment

Interactive Video

Information Technology (IT), Architecture

University

Hard

Created by

Quizizz Content

FREE Resource

The video tutorial discusses the evolution of Java's release cycle, highlighting the shift to a biannual release schedule starting with Java 10. It covers the history of Java versions, emphasizing the significance of Java 8 for introducing functional programming. The tutorial explains the time-based release versioning strategy and the concept of long-term support (LTS) versions, recommending their use for production environments. The video aims to provide a comprehensive overview of Java versioning and its recent developments.

Read more

5 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

How often are new Java releases scheduled to be released?

Every year

Every three months

Every six months

Every two years

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which Java version is considered significant for introducing functional programming?

Java SCR 8

Java C5.0

Java C9

Java C10

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What major change in Java versioning started with Java C10?

Switch to time-based release versioning

Introduction of object-oriented programming

Inclusion of graphical user interfaces

Support for mobile applications

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of long-term support (LTS) versions in Java?

To ensure stability and extended support

To reduce the size of the Java runtime

To provide frequent updates

To introduce experimental features

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which Java version is the last long-term support release mentioned in the transcript?

Java C-11

Java C-16

Java C-17

Java C-10